: This time, Brown turns his attention to the political world and NASA. Intelligence analyst Rachel Sexton is summoned to the Arctic to authenticate an astonishing discovery by NASA: a meteorite containing fossilized evidence of extraterrestrial life, just as the space agency faces severe budget cuts. As she investigates, she uncovers a shocking conspiracy that takes her from the frozen Arctic to the corridors of power in Washington D.C.
